Locked On Fantasy Basketball podcast is your daily ticket to stay ahead of the game and the first to know the latest news, analysis, and insider info for all things fantasy basketball. Host Josh Lloyd will help guide your team to glory as he takes you beyond the scoreboard for the inside scoops on the biggest stories from all over the NBA but with a distinct fantasy slant.   • Fantasy Basketball Statistical Correlations & Why Turnovers Suck 15.07.2026 40min
    Unlock the secrets of NBA fantasy success by mastering category correlations, are you building your team on a rock-solid foundation or setting yourself up for disappointment? Josh Lloyd reveals why targeting assists and points brings natural synergy, highlights the pitfalls of pairing three-pointers with field goal percentage, and questions the real value of low turnovers in head-to-head leagues.
